Original content

Ukrainian farmers are likely to increase corn and sunflower crops in the spring campaign, Svetlana Lytvyn, head of the analytical department of the Ukrainian Club of Agrarian Business (UCAB), was quoted as saying by agroportal.ua. According to Lytvyn, the area sown with spring crops, along with winter wheat, barley and rapeseed in the current season, may remain at the level of 2024 and reach 19 million hectares. Sunflower is expected to occupy the largest area - 5.1 million hectares, which is 4% more than last year. Due to the shortage of raw materials for the processing industry last year, sunflower prices increased, but in 2025 Ukraine may influence the market with larger quantities if climatic conditions allow for a quality harvest. The next crop in terms of area in Ukraine is wheat. The areas sown with the crop are estimated at about 4.8 million ha, which is 2% less than the previous year.
